> I'm using emacs with LANG=fr_FR.UTF-8. When using C-x v +
> (`vc-update') on a file versionned with SVN, emacs barfs saying it
> can't parse the output from "svn update". Indeed, SVN said "À la
> révision 123" whereas "At revision 123" was expected. The following
> patch adds "LC_MESSAGES=C" to process-environment before calling
> external tools; this solves the problem for my case.
Thanks, the patch looks good. I've checked it into the Emacs
repository.
